ASL 2 - Unit 11

Describing Objects



In this unit as you are learning sign language online, you will be learning how to describe objects.

Describing Objects

Another good way to practice using classifiers is to describe objects. You can use classifiers to show the size of objects as well as attachments or other features. You can also use certain mouth movements to show how small or large something is as well as use instrument classifiers to show how it is held or used.
